Son pocas las personas que se dedican a velar por el respeto a las garantías individuales y la defensa los derechos humanos. Este solo hecho ya las hace excepcionales. Por esta misma razón, merecen un mayor reconocimiento debido a las dificultades, el alto costo personal e incluso los peligros que implica este oficio en una cultura donde la actuación del gobierno y otros actores involucrados en este tema es controversial, como es el caso de México. En este libro se presentan los testimonios de 18 personas que han dedicado su vida a defender a escala local, regional, nacional e internacional, los derechos de los demás. Son mujeres y hombres que comparten los motivos que les llevaron a ejercer esta actividad como una opción y estilo de vida, así como su particular forma de llevar a cabo su lucha y el recuento de sus logros y vicisitudes. A partir de estos testimonios, se analizan las características fundamentales de la génesis y práctica del oficio de ombudsman, en aras de entender su peculiar habitus, con la esperanza de impulsar a más hombres y mujeres a adoptar sin temor esta profesión de un gran impacto social que, sí, puede ser de alto riesgo, aunque se olvida ante la gran satisfacción personal que brinda a quien la desempeña. This book puts forward proposals for solutions to the current gaps between the Mexican legal order and the norms and principles of international criminal law. Adequate legislative measures are suggested for compliance with international obligations. The author approaches the book's subject matter by tracing all norms related to the prosecution of core crimes and contextualizing each of the findings with a brief historical and political account. Additionally, state practice is analyzed, identifying patterns and inconsistencies. This approach is new in offering a wide perspective on international criminal law in Mexico. Relevant legal documents are analyzed and annexed in the book, providing the reader with a useful guide to the topics analyzed. Issues including the following are examined: the incorporation of core crimes in the Mexican legal order, military jurisdiction, the war crimes definition under Mexican law, unaddressed atrocities, state practice and future challenges to combat impunity. The book will be of relevance to legal scholars, students, practitioners of law and human rights advocates. It also offers interesting insights to political scientists, historians and journalists. Mexico’s Reforma, the mid-nineteenth-century liberal revolution, decisively shaped the country by disestablishing the Catholic Church, secularizing public affairs, and laying the foundations of a truly national economy and culture. The Lawyer of the Church is an examination of the Mexican clergy’s response to the Reforma through a study of the life and works of Bishop Clemente de Jesús Munguía (1810–68), one of the most influential yet least-known figures of the period. By analyzing how Munguía responded to changing political and intellectual scenarios in defense of the clergy’s legal prerogatives and social role, Pablo Mijangos y González argues that the Catholic Church opposed the liberal revolution not because of its supposed attachment to a bygone past but rather because of its efforts to supersede colonial tradition and refashion itself within a liberal yet confessional state. With an eye on the international influences and dimensions of the Mexican church-state conflict, The Lawyer of the Church also explores how Mexican bishops gradually tightened their relationship with the Holy See and simultaneously managed to incorporate the papacy into their local affairs, thus paving the way for the eventual “Romanization” of Mexican Catholicism during the later decades of the century.

Since the explosion of the indignados movement beginning in 2011, there has been a renewed interest in the concept of the “public sphere” in a Spanish context: how it relates to society and to political power, and how it has evolved over the centuries. The Configuration of the Spanish Public Sphere brings together contributions from leading scholars in Hispanic studies, across a wide range of disciplines, to investigate various aspects of these processes, offering a long-term, panoramic view that touches on one of the most urgent issues for contemporary European societies.

Esta compilación de ensayos, Violencia y Derechos Humanos: México, Colombia y El Salvador, es el resultado del trabajo de un grupo de investigadoras preocupadas por la violencia y las violaciones de los derechos humanos en diferentes espacios geográficos del subcontinente. Las autoras abordan los problemas que tienen presencia en las agendas sociopolíticas actuales de la zona, desde una perspectiva histórica, por un lado, y sociopolítica por otro. La intención es crear un marco histórico-teórico que combinado con una perspectiva social recopile testimonios de los afectados, explicando a su vez las razones estructurales de esta situación. La contextualización de los fenómenos analizados resulta útil para comprender la situación actual. La historia dota de profundidad a los acontecimientos descritos en los textos que integran este libro, y la recopilación de testimonios complementan este recorrido.

Héctor Fix-Fierro y Jaqueline Martínez hacen una minuciosa revisión de la génesis y la evolución del modelo de derechos en la Constitución, el cual ha pasado de las “garantías individuales y sociales” de 1917 a los “derechos humanos” consagrados en el texto constitucional del centenario, dando cuenta de la transición democrática pero también de los retos que aún quedan en materia de derechos humanos.

Este libro estudia la relación del sistema de justicia con la sociedad desde una mirada histórica. Se parte de la idea de que ha habido un deterioro, una separación cada vez más amplia, en esta relación, proceso que parece haberse acelerado durante los siglos XIX y XX. Los autores de este libro se han interesado en seguir, en diferentes momentos y espacios, a los diferentes actores sociales involucrados, tanto los letrados como los legos, para analizar el funcionamiento en la impartición de la justicia; asimismo han explorado diversos archivos para entender cómo la evolución de la justicia y de la cultura jurídica, desde las reformas borbónicas hasta hoy, alteró esta relación. Este volumen es el resultado de un trabajo colectivo de cinco años que recibió el apoyo del programa ECOS-Norte binacional, de Francia y México.
